2. Key Components of the Hydraulic Power Pack Circuit

The Intelitek hydraulic power pack circuit diagram typically involves several key components that work together to provide hydraulic power for a wide variety of machines and tools. These components include:

  • Hydraulic Pump – The pump is the heart of the power pack, converting mechanical energy into hydraulic energy. It draws fluid from the reservoir and pumps it through the system under high pressure to power various actuators.
  • Electric Motor – The motor drives the hydraulic pump, typically powered by AC or DC current depending on the system requirements. The motor ensures the pump runs continuously, maintaining a consistent flow of hydraulic fluid.
  • Hydraulic Reservoir – The reservoir stores the hydraulic fluid used in the system, ensuring a steady supply and managing the fluid’s temperature.
  • Pressure Relief Valve – This valve is crucial for protecting the system from excessive pressure. It regulates the flow of fluid to maintain the optimal operating pressure.
  • Control Valve – The control valve directs the hydraulic fluid to the appropriate areas of the system, depending on the application, such as controlling the speed and direction of a hydraulic cylinder.
  • Hydraulic Cylinders and Actuators – These components convert the hydraulic energy into mechanical force, powering various parts of the machine, like lifts, presses, and automated arms.
  • Filters – To prevent damage to the components, the filters ensure the hydraulic fluid remains clean and free from contaminants that could cause wear and tear in the system.

3. Working Principles of the Hydraulic Power Pack System

The working principle of a hydraulic power pack system involves converting mechanical power from an electric motor into hydraulic energy using a pump. The control valve regulates the flow and direction of the fluid, allowing for precise control over the movement of the actuators.

Additionally, the pressure relief valve ensures that the pressure within the system does not exceed the designed limit, preventing damage to components and ensuring safe operation. As the fluid returns from the actuators, it is filtered and sent back into the reservoir for reuse, creating a closed-loop system. 5. Troubleshooting the Hydraulic Power Pack Circuit

When using a hydraulic power pack, understanding the circuit diagram is essential for diagnosing issues and performing maintenance. Some common problems that may arise with hydraulic power packs include:

  • Insufficient Pressure – If the hydraulic system is not generating enough pressure, it could be due to a faulty pump, clogged filters, or a damaged pressure relief valve. The circuit diagram helps identify where the issue may lie, allowing for a targeted solution.
  • Overheating – If the hydraulic fluid is overheating, it may be due to improper fluid levels, blocked cooling systems, or a failing motor. By checking the schematic, users can locate potential causes and address them efficiently.
  • Fluid Leaks – Leaks in the system can lead to a loss of pressure and affect the overall performance. Common causes of leaks include damaged hoses, loose fittings, or worn seals. The circuit diagram helps in identifying areas prone to leaks.
  • Unresponsive Actuators – If the actuators are not moving as expected, the issue could be with the control valve, valve spool, or a clogged filter. The diagram can pinpoint the components that may need inspection or replacement.
